Stress is an important factor in psychosis, so you are probably right that they both contributed. 6 months of symptoms is a criterion for diagnosis if your doctor uses the DSM. If he/she uses ICD-10 then the criterion is that you must have had symptoms most of the time for at least 1 month. I quit smoking weed recently, it gave me anxiety.
